Hi, and welcome to the rotation. The Markprint pipeline converts user markdown into sanitized HTML, and the sanitizer stage is the part you'll care about most. Any bypass of the allowlist filter is treated as a security incident, not a bug. If you see rendered output containing script tags or event attributes, page the security rotation immediately and freeze the affected render queue. Please read the pipeline architecture notes and the incident playbook before your first shift; they are here:

wiki page, fahaf-yagag: https://confluence.qorvellabs.internal/pages/display/pages/display

Subject: Quick update on the Fennwick licensing mess

Hi all,

Short version: Fennwick Systems is still disputing our renewal terms on the Oriel toolkit, and their counsel sent another letter Tuesday. Mara thinks we settle by quarter-end; I'm less sure. Please hold any public comments and route press questions to Devra. Heads of department should brief their teams only on a need-to-know basis. Context for the exec team follows below.

management briefing: Jorixax Holdings is in early talks to buy Casixax Holdings for about $420.3 million. The Fenmir launch date is October 27, and nothing goes to the press before then. Legal wants the Keloxek Foods term sheet redrafted before April 16.

// REINDEX_BATCH_CAP limits docs per shard pass in the Tallowfield
// nightly search reindex. Raising it starves the ingest queue;
// lowering it overruns the maintenance window. 5000 is the tested
// sweet spot. Change only with a soak run. Verified against the
// build noted below.

session token of bawif-hahog = htk6_ac5981